FeatureMoinMoinzk
CategoryWikis & DocumentationWikis & Documentation
LicenseGPL-2.0GPL-3.0
LanguagePythonGo
Setup difficultyMediumEasy
Min. RAM256 MB64 MB
Deploymentbare-metal, sourcebinary, source
GitHub stars★ 372★ 2,748
First released20002021
ReplacesConfluenceRoam Research, Obsidian
